On August 19th Tesla hosted “AI Day,” which came with a spate of details about the company’s innovative technology for their vehicles—and an AI robot. Dubbed Tesla Bot, its purpose will be to eliminate tasks that are considered “dangerous, repetitive and boring” such as using a wrench to fix a car part, according to CEO Elon Musk. The technology behind Tesla Bot is reportedly derived from the same mechanics powering its vehicles. “It makes sense to put that onto humanoid form,” Musk said. “This, I think, will be quite profound. With three simple words, Elon Musk lit a fuse in the crypto community that could eventually lead to a Dogecoin-themed music festival: “Sounds kinda fun.” The comment came in response to a popular Dogecoin fan account who tweeted about the fictitious DogeFest, using a photo of a music festival stage edited with the token’s viral Shiba Inu meme imagery. He then started a thread to suggest what the festival would entail if it were real, such as a DJ set from Musk himself, who has long championed EDM and recently teased the sale of an NFT techno song. The page also suggested that DogeFest would require Dogecoin “as payment for everything.” Once Musk chimed in, legions of crypto supporters joined the conversation to conceptualize the fest. It looks like plenty of investors were also underwhelmed, because Musk’s net worth reportedly dropped by a whopping $20 billion (!) after his SNL episode aired. As the cofounder and CEO of Tesla, Musk took quite the hit on Wall Street following his appearance. According to estimates by Forbes, shares of Tesla have fallen more than 15% so far this week, lowering Musk’s net worth by $20.5 billion total. Last night, Elon Musk hosted Saturday Night Live to the chagrin of many and for a variety of reasons. While the episode was mostly boring and at times, pretty flat, one somewhat good moment came when Musk’s partner, Grimes, appeared on a Super Mario Bros. courtroom sketch where Wario is on trial for taking out Mario, while Luigi is on the stand. In it, Musk played Super Mario Bros. villain Wario while Grimes popped up as Princess Peach. She had a few lines and was called out for sending an… interesting text message as well.
